Senior Photo Locations on ASU's Campus

Arizona State University has a beautiful campus, with many different options for photo locations. Two of the most iconic, and most popular spots to take your senior portraits on the Tempe campus are Old Main, and Palm Walk. Old Man is certainly iconic, as it’s the oldest building on campus, and features a gorgeous fountain on it’s front lawn. The weeks leading up to graduation, this place becomes packed with photographers and seniors for photos. Plan to wait a while in line to get your photos on the steps, and on the landing beside the plaque. 

Palm Walk is a hotspot on campus, and for good reason. You can get some great instagram worthy shots with the palms lining the sidewalk and definitely gives the ASU vibe.

And, there are many other great locations on campus too. Some other locations include the walkway over University Drive, the ASU signs near Old Main, WP Carey School, and Hayden Library. And, its’ really up to you. Are there some special areas of campus that you like and want to include? Plus, don’t forget about your major’s building!

Go Off Campus For Your Senior Photos

Looking for something a little different? We can always go off campus to make your session unique! There’s lots of local areas that are great for photo sessions, including Papago Park, Usery Mountain Regional Park, the Superstitions, and the Salt River.

Plan Ahead: Senior Portrait Tips for ASU Graduation Season

The 3–4 weeks leading up to graduation—especially in the spring—are the busiest time of year for senior portraits. If you’re hoping to capture your college memories with a session near iconic campus spots like Old Main, don’t wait! I highly recommend scheduling your session as early as possible to avoid the crowds.

During the busy season, expect to wait in line for popular spots like the stairs at Old Main—it’s a favorite location for grads and often has a line of seniors ready for their turn.

To secure your preferred date and time, be sure to book in advance. Dates fill up quickly, and there are only so many available portrait sessions during this peak time. Don’t worry if you don’t have your cap and gown yet—you can still schedule your shoot. Many seniors borrow from friends or grads from the previous year, so you don’t have to wait to get on the calendar.
